Output dda4f333795bce972bb003c264ce39e98426025cdceed26fa0835c69f3b9a07f:0

value
1086065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c45703d5e0c3f6e69d0519af42798a49e42f8966 OP_EQUAL
address
3KbAc3ph1u1uVkbJdaZidb1128GzgvPi4o
transaction
dda4f333795bce972bb003c264ce39e98426025cdceed26fa0835c69f3b9a07f
spent
true